Love's Travel Stop is a dog-friendly gas station and rest stop near Blytheville, Arkansas. Love's Travel Stops are located all throughout the United States and provide facilities for traveling dogs. A completely fenced dog park with a convenient waste station is available at this site.

Herman Davis Memorial State Park

Herman Davis Memorial State Park is named after Herman Davis, a scout and sharpshooter who grew up hunting near Manila. He was a hero during World War I, and his final resting place is commemorated with a statue and a monument at this historic site.

Earl Bell Dog Park

Earl Bell Dog Park welcomes pets. This off-leash dog park is divided into two sections, one for dogs under 30 pounds and the other for dogs 30 pounds and up. A watering station and bags to clean up after your dog are also available at the park. Earl Bell Dog Park is open from 7 a.m. to 8 p.m. every day of the week.

Lake Frierson State Park

A barrier-free fishing pier, bathrooms, pathways, and the beauty of the wild dogwoods are just a few of the attractions of Lake Frierson State Park for you and your dog to enjoy. Simply keep Petzooie leashed at all times. This park, which is located on the shores of the 335-acre Lake Frierson, is a great spot to unwind and enjoy year-round fishing for bream, catfish, crappie, saugeye, and bass.

Craighead Forest Park

Craighead Forest Park welcomes pets. This 692-acre park, which features a man-made lake, walking and hiking trails, and a dog dock near the boat launch, is located in the scenic grandeur of Crowley's Ridge. Take a stroll along the boardwalk with your leashed dog, as long as they clean up after themselves. The park opens at 6 a.m. every day of the week.

Lake Poinsett State Park

At Lake Poinsett State Park, take a leisurely walk with your dog along the 1.1-mile Great Blue Heron Trail or go fishing in the lake. Most outdoor places allow pets as long as they are restrained physically or on a leash no longer than six feet. Owners of noisy or dangerous pets, as well as pets that harm or harass wildlife, will be asked to remove them. Pets are not permitted in or around hotel establishments. There are many picnic tables for family lunches, a heated and cooled pavilion, a children's playground, and an open field for ball games in the day-use area.
